使用YouTube API在PHP中获取YouTube视频描述和评论的步骤如下:
require_once 'vendor/autoload.php';
$client = new Google_Client();
$client->setDeveloperKey('YOUR_API_KEY');
$youtube = new Google_Service_YouTube($client);
$videoId = 'YOUR_VIDEO_ID';
$videoResponse = $youtube->videos->listVideos('snippet', array(
'id' => $videoId
));
$video = $videoResponse->items[0];
$description = $video->snippet->description;
$commentsResponse = $youtube->commentThreads->listCommentThreads('snippet', array(
'videoId' => $videoId
));
$comments = $commentsResponse->items;
foreach ($comments as $comment) {
$commentText = $comment->snippet->topLevelComment->snippet->textDisplay;
// 处理评论内容
}
这样,你就可以在PHP中使用YouTube API获取YouTube视频的描述和评论了。
请注意,以上代码仅为示例,你需要根据实际情况进行适当的错误处理和数据处理。另外,YouTube API还提供了许多其他功能,如搜索视频、获取频道信息等,你可以根据需要进一步扩展你的应用程序。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云